2016 Priorat, Mas de la Rosa Vinyes Velles, Familia Torres
Glistening ruby-red. Highly perfumed aromas of fresh red and blue fruits, candied lavender and exotic spices are complemented by a smoky mineral overtone. Sappy and energetic on the palate, offering intense black raspberry, cherry and floral pastille flavors that slowly put on weight and turn spicier through the midpalate. The floral and mineral qualities repeat emphatically on the gently tannic finish, which clings with serious tenacity and persistent spiciness. Sourced from a 1.9-hectare, high-altitude plot that was planted in the mid-1930s. ~ (97) Josh Raynolds, Vinous 3-1-2021
First vintage of this single-vineyard Vinyes Velles wine; the first time in Spain that two producers share the same name (Torres and Vall Llach). Two hectares of coolly sited 80-year-old vines at 500 m near Porrera. 60% Cariñena, 40% Garnacha. Field blend. The old owner Sr Manolo, who always sold his grapes, didn’t have children who wanted to take it over. Short, 11-day vatting. 16 months in French oak barrels. Very fresh and sumptuous. Very unlike most Priorats. Polished. Very long and exceptionally fresh. Miguel Torres Maczassek is clearly very proud of this new, fresh style: 'it's all about fruit character'. The wine comes in a burgundy bottle. ~ (17) Jancis Robinson, JancisRobinson.com 4-15-2019
When I visited the Mas de la Rosa Vineyard, I also tasted all the vintages produced so far, including the initial 2016 Mas de la Rosa, which I had tasted in 2018 before it was bottled. 2016 was an exceptional year in the zone, mild and dry, with a long vegetative cycle and very good ripeness, and there was a late harvest after some rains that cooled things down. They picked the grapes the 28th of October, 60% Cariñena and 40% Garnacha. It has 14.5% alcohol and a pH of 3.22 and 6.02 grams of acidity (in tartaric acid per liter). The varieties fermented separately, and the wine matured in 500-liter oak barrels for 16 months. This 2016 felt quite oaky, and it suffered in comparison with the other vintages because it was the first vintage and they were still finding their way. This is still going to need more time. 1,957 bottles, 67 magnums and 35 double magnums were filled in July 2018. ~ (94) Luis Gutiérrez, Robert Parker's Wine Advocate 9-30-2022
